The children's math education franchise market is experiencing robust growth, driven by increasing parental concern over children's math skills and the rising demand for supplemental education. The market, estimated at $10 billion in 2025, is projected to experience a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033, reaching approximately $17 billion by 2033. This growth is fueled by several factors, including the increasing adoption of innovative teaching methodologies like gamification and technology integration, the expanding middle class in developing economies, and the growing awareness of the long-term benefits of early math education. The segment catering to children aged 5-12 is the largest, driven by parental focus on building a strong foundation in mathematics during these formative years. Competition within the market is intense, with established players like Mathnasium and Kumon competing with newer entrants offering specialized programs or digital platforms. The market is geographically diverse, with North America and Asia Pacific currently dominating market share, though regions like Africa and South America are exhibiting significant growth potential.


Geographic expansion and strategic partnerships are key strategies employed by franchisors to increase their market presence. Challenges include maintaining consistent quality across franchises, adapting to evolving educational trends, and effectively managing marketing and branding in a competitive landscape. The continued rise in technology is likely to reshape the market, with a growing emphasis on online learning platforms and blended learning models offering greater flexibility and convenience. The success of individual franchises will hinge on their ability to adapt to these changes, leverage technology effectively, and provide high-quality, engaging math instruction tailored to individual student needs. The market shows strong potential for continued growth, propelled by increasing parental investment in education and the enduring importance of a strong mathematical foundation for future success.

Several key factors are fueling the expansion of the children's math education franchise market. Firstly, the increasing emphasis on STEM education globally is creating a heightened demand for early math skills development. Parents recognize the crucial role of a strong math foundation in future academic and career success, leading to increased investment in supplementary math programs. Secondly, the evolution of teaching methodologies incorporates gamification, interactive software, and personalized learning plans, creating more engaging and effective learning experiences. This, in turn, attracts more students and parents seeking superior results compared to traditional classroom settings. Thirdly, the franchising model itself offers scalability and proven business models, making it attractive to entrepreneurs seeking to enter the education sector. The lower risk associated with a franchise compared to starting a business from scratch attracts investment and fuels market growth. Finally, technological advancements continuously improve the quality and accessibility of educational resources. Online learning platforms, interactive apps, and personalized learning software are becoming increasingly integrated into franchise offerings, enhancing the learning experience and expanding market reach.
Despite the positive growth outlook, the children's math education franchise market faces several challenges. The high initial investment required to establish a franchise can be a barrier to entry for potential franchisees. Maintaining consistent quality across multiple franchise locations requires rigorous training and ongoing support, which can be costly. Competition within the market is fierce, with established brands and new entrants vying for market share, requiring constant innovation and adaptation. Economic downturns or changes in government policies impacting education spending can also negatively impact market growth. Furthermore, adapting to evolving educational standards and incorporating new technologies requires ongoing investment and training. Successfully managing brand reputation and customer satisfaction across numerous locations is essential for long-term success and sustainable growth. Finally, attracting and retaining qualified and experienced math tutors is a recurring challenge for many franchises, particularly during periods of economic expansion.
